The Verdict: Which is Better?

When placing Organic Breakfast Bread Raisin' The Roof! and Frosted Flakes side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.

For calorie-conscious consumers, Organic Breakfast Bread Raisin' The Roof! is the clear winner. With 95 fewer calories per 100g than its competitor, it allows for more volume while keeping your energy intake in check.

In terms of sugar control, Organic Breakfast Bread Raisin' The Roof! takes the lead with only 20.6g of sugar per 100g, whereas Frosted Flakes contains 36.1g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.

Looking to build muscle? Organic Breakfast Bread Raisin' The Roof! offers a protein boost with 11.8g per 100g, outperforming Frosted Flakes in this category.
